The Fed held interest rates steady yesterday but pushed back on the prospect of rate cuts in March. US equities took a hit on Wednesday after some of the biggest names failed to live up to high expectations, dragging European markets lower in the afternoon session. Softer price data out of Europe and concerns over a regional US bank led to a rally in bonds.
